With this brilliant debut, Penner thoughtfully upends the tropes of postapocalyptic fiction -- Publishers Weekly Strange Labour is a powerful meditation on the meaning of humanity in a universe that is indifferent to our extinction, and a provocative re-imagining of many of the tropes and clich s that have shaped the post-apocalyptic novel. Most people have deserted the cities and towns to work themselves to death in the construction of monumental earthworks. The only adults unaffected by this mysterious obsession are a dwindling population that live in the margins of a new society they cannot understand. Isolated, in an increasingly deserted landscape, living off the material remnants of the old order, trapped in antiquated habits and assumptions, they struggle to construct a meaningful life for themselves. Miranda, a young woman who travels across what had once been the West, meets Dave, who has peculiar theories about the apocalypse.…

Molly McGhee, author of Jonathan Abernathy You Are KindThe empire on which the sun never sets has turned its ambitions toward a land where its never even risen: Victorian Britain is colonizing Hell itself.The demons who once ran amok down there, torturing lost souls, were easy enough to subdue. The damned, left without tormentors, have been put to work on cotton and tobacco plantations. As for the colonists, it takes all sorts to stake a claim on the infernal frontier: theres MacTavish, the dissipated District Commissioner; the savvy spiritualist Penelope Hodgson-Huntley; the preachers-son-turned-engineer Elijah Biddle; a cartful of orphaned girls sent down as part of an immigration scheme; and a zealous missionary offering salvation to the living and the dead alike.Backed by the power of Britain at its globe-spanning peak, however, the great and good of the colony will not be content until they have plundered even the unconquered interior: Hell Undiminished. All thats needed is a pretext for taking up armsand when a series of lurid murders sends the lonely farms and towns of British Hell into a panic, war seems inevitable. Will Her Majestys colonial forces prove victorious, or will they be made, at last, to give the devil his due?Set when the Old Empire of sails, slavery, and spices was transforming into the New Imperialism of steam and scientific racism, Notes on a Colonial Situation in Hell is one-of-a-kind feat of the imagination. It is at once a raucous, biting satire of the ignorance and hubris that built our world; an epic quest into the darkest heart of darkness imaginable; and an epic as gripping as anything by Conrad, Forster, or Tolkien. Clean, tight, unmarked; absolute minimal wear; appears unread; The majority of the global population have left the cities and towns to become diggers and work themselves to death in the construction of monumental earthworks. The adults unaffected by this mysterious obsession are part of a dwindling population that survives in the margins of a new society, struggling to construct a meaningful future for themselves. Miranda travels alone across what had once been the American West. After taking care of, and then abandoning a group of dementia patients, she meets Dave, who becomes her travelling companion. Dave recounts his many theories about how and why the apocalypse happened, as they search among the dispossessed for a place called Big Echo. A mesmerizing and uncanny meditation on the meaning of humanity in a universe indifferent to our extinction. This is the unforgettable first novel of Robert G. Penner.…
